The National Weather Service in Hastings has issued a
* Severe Thunderstorm Warning for…
East central Furnas County in south central Nebraska…
Southwestern Harlan County in south central Nebraska…
* Until 715 PM CDT.
* At 644 PM CDT, a severe thunderstorm was located over Stamford, or
22 miles northeast of Norton, moving northeast at 10 mph.
HAZARD…60 mph wind gusts and half dollar size hail.
SOURCE…Radar indicated.
IMPACT…Hail damage to vehicles is expected. Expect wind damage
to roofs, siding, and trees.
* This severe thunderstorm will be near…
Stamford around 650 PM CDT.
Instructions
For your protection move to an interior room on the lowest floor of a
building.
